Fumigation Service in Bellingham, WA
Fumigation services involve the controlled application of chemical treatments to eliminate pests, insects, or rodents from residential properties. These treatments are typically used for severe infestations or when pests have penetrated hard-to-reach areas, such as inside walls, attics, or storage spaces. Projects often include treating entire homes, basements, or specific areas like garages and crawl spaces to ensure thorough pest eradication and prevent future issues.
Homeowners considering fumigation should understand the scope of the treatment, including the areas covered and any preparations needed before the service. It’s also important to inquire about the types of pests targeted, the chemicals used, and any safety precautions to take during and after treatment. Proper communication helps ensure the process is effective and safe for everyone in the household.

Fumigation Service Questions
What types of pests can be eliminated with fumigation? Fumigation effectively targets a variety of pests including termites, bed bugs, fleas, and stored product insects.
Is fumigation suitable for all property types? Fumigation services are commonly used for residential homes, commercial buildings, and storage facilities requiring pest eradication.
How does fumigation work to remove pests? The process involves sealing the area and releasing a gas that penetrates pests' hiding spots, eliminating infestations efficiently.
What should property owners do before a fumigation service? Property owners should remove food, personal items, and pets, and follow any preparation instructions provided to ensure safety and effectiveness.
